Robust multi-view L2 triangulation via optimal inlier selection and 3D structure refinement

Highlights:

• The uncertainty of epipolar transfer is analytically characterized.

• Two new algorithms to calculate the error bounds of 3D structure are proposed.

• A new robust formulation of direct multi-view triangulation is proposed.

• Our method can identify more inliers than existing robust triangulation strategies.

• Our method can reconstruct more unambiguous 3D points with higher accuracy.
